Предметом насто щего изобретени вл етс способ получени среднего фосфорнокислого натри из феррофосфора .The subject of the present invention is a process for the preparation of medium sodium phosphate from ferrophosphorus.
Тонко размолотый феррофосфор тщательно смешивают с размолотым железопиритом из расчета 1 моль Fe.,P на б молей FeS.,, и смесь сплавл етс в закрь1том тигле при температуре 700-800 в течение 2 часов,The finely milled ferrophosphorus is thoroughly mixed with milled ferropyrite at the rate of 1 mole of Fe., P per b moles of FeS., And the mixture is fused in a closed crucible at a temperature of 700-800 for 2 hours,
Полученный сплав обрабатываетс избыточным количеством концентрированной сол ной кислоты, и выдел ющийс при этом сероводород используетс дл тех или иных целей.The resulting alloy is treated with excess concentrated hydrochloric acid, and the hydrogen sulfide released during this process is used for various purposes.
По окончании реакции непрореагировавцдий остаток отфильтровываетс , а фильтрат, после упарки, обрабатываетс концентрированным раствором едкого натра дл осаждени гидрата закиси железа и нейтрализации фосфорной кислоты.At the end of the reaction, the unreacted residue is filtered, and the filtrate, after evaporation, is treated with a concentrated solution of caustic soda to precipitate ferrous oxide and neutralize phosphoric acid.
Осадок гидроокиси железа отфильтровываетс , после чего фильтрат выпариваетс , и из него выкристаллизовываетс фосфорнокислый натрий с примесью соды и хлористого натри .The iron hydroxide precipitate is filtered off, after which the filtrate is evaporated, and sodium phosphate crystallizes out of it, mixed with soda and sodium chloride.
Количество извлеченного этим путем фосфора из феррофосфора достигает 75% от теории.The amount of phosphorus extracted from ferrophosphorus by this way reaches 75% of the theory.
Вместо сол ной кислоты дл обработки фосфиднопиритного сплава может быть применена азотна кислота, в результате чего выдел етс элементарна сера, по отделении которой дальнейша переработка раствора ведетс так же, как в случае применени сол ной кислоты.Instead of hydrochloric acid, nitric acid can be used to treat the phosphide pyrite alloy, as a result of which elemental sulfur is released, after which the further processing of the solution is carried out in the same way as in the case of using hydrochloric acid.
При азотнокислом варианте процент использовани фосфора из феррофосфора повышаетс до 90%. Конечный продукт - фосфат натри содержит примеси соды и селитры.In the case of the nitric acid variant, the percentage of phosphorus from ferrophosphorus rises to 90%. The final product, sodium phosphate, contains impurities of soda and nitrate.
